School Crime in Belle Plaine

9 incidents reported at K-12 schools across Belle Plaine in 2024 — city-wide, not specific to any one school.

School Crime Rate
211% above Iowa avg
18.79
per 1,000 students

School Offense Breakdown

Violent
9

School Crime Types

  • Assault100%

School Crime Rate is per 1,000 students enrolled. Source: FBI NIBRS 2024. Figures are city-wide; NIBRS does not report the specific school or address.

Overall Crime in Belle Plaine

112 total incidents reported across Belle Plaine in 2024 — all locations, city-wide.

Overall Crime Rate
8% above Iowa avg
47.74
per 1,000 residents

Offense Breakdown

Violent
49
Property
50
Drug
13

Crime Types

  • Assault43%
  • Theft27%
  • Drugs12%
  • Vandalism10%
  • Burglary4%
  • Vehicle Theft2%
  • Other3%

Overall Crime Rate is per 1,000 residents. Source: FBI NIBRS 2024. City-wide totals across all reported incidents and locations.
